{"product_id":"9781515414179","title":"Twenty Years at Hull House","description":"Hull-House is a settlement house in the United States that was co-founded in 1889 by Jane Addams and Ellen Gates Starr. Located in the Near West Side of Chicago, Illinois, Hull-House opened its doors to the recently arrived European immigrants. By 1911, Hull-House had grown to 13 buildings. In 1912 the Hull-House complex was completed with the addition of a summer camp, the Bowen Country Club. With its innovative social, educational, and artistic programs, Hull-House became the standard bearer for the movement that had grown, by 1920, to almost 500 settlement houses nationally.","brand":"Dancing Unicorn Books","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":47108789862640,"sku":"9781515414179","price":1.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0737\/7593\/9824\/files\/9781515414179_p0.jpg?v=1769898291","url":"https:\/\/shop-qa.barnesandnoble.com\/products\/9781515414179","provider":"Barnes \u0026 Noble (DEV)","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
